Coronectomy in South African Context
Common Coding Approaches:
Surgical Extraction Codes:
Often, surgeons use a coding approach that best fits the surgical removal of a tooth, such as a modifier with a lower-impact extraction code, as the roots are not removed.
Unlisted Procedure Code (8999):
If no specific code covers the procedure, 8999 is typically used to indicate an “unlisted procedure” in the South African dental tariff structure.
Detailed Motivation:
When billing, it is mandatory to provide a detailed clinical report (special report) justifying the use of a coronectomy over a full extraction (e.g., risk of nerve damage, radiographic findings) to ensure the medical aid understands the procedure.
